Floor shifter for Saginaw 3-speed '87.

Hello all. I'm in the process of getting my '87 ready for summer. I'm 3/4 of the way through new cab mounts (had to drill out every stinkin' bolt but one!) and am installing a new clutch, pressure plate, and flywheel. I re-sealed the Saginaw 3-speed so it should be ready to go. Only thing is I have had ZERO luck finding missing linkage components for the 3-speed column shift.

At this point I've pretty much given up and resigned myself to cutting a hole and going with a floor shifter. Here's the thing: I'm trying to do it on a budget and don't want to spend $500 on a Hurst Mastershift for a trans I might not keep in the truck (I want to keep it a stick but might eventually go with a 4 or 5 speed).

I've been looking on FB marketplace and have found quite a few factory 'ITM' shifters for Camaros/Firebirds with all linkage for $100 or less. That's more budget friendly. Has anyone on here used one of these? Should I go for it or run from it?

Curious to know what you guys recommend for other options? Thank you! -Marc.
